I liked ETN's last TD vs Syracuse in 2018
Aug 28, 2021, 1:00 AM
|
|
He had 203 yards and 3 TDs but the last one with 41 seconds remaining put us up 27-23 after being down 16-7 and 23-13 and after losing to them in 2017 and after all the QB drama and Chase Brice having to be the long reliever/closer. The game also had Xavier Thomas' monster sack on Eric Dungey with about a half minute left. The comeback win of course saved the undefeated 15-0 season.
